SHIRLEY LEE WATKINS
MUSCATINE, IA – Shirley Watkins peacefully departed on July 24, 2026, at her country home at Lutheran Living in Muscatine, Iowa. Born on December 9, 1931, in Kirksville, Missouri, Shirley was the daughter of Archie and Lemah Truitt. Her life was full of family and friends.
Shirley grew up in Kirksville, Missouri, graduated from Kirksville High School and furthered her education at Northeast Missouri State University, earning a Bachelor of Arts degree. It was in college that she met Rick Watkins. They married on February 27, 1951, and shared a beautiful partnership.
They spent 15 years in Toledo, Iowa as the kids grew older before moving to Muscatine Iowa in 1974.
Together, Shirley and Rick embarked on many adventures, trips, and created treasured memories during their twenty winters spent in Casa Grande, Arizona. Their hearts were always open to their children, grandchildren, and to the friends they made along the way.
Shirley loved her family. She is survived by her children, Terri Baker, Kent Watkins, Pam Pulliam and their spouses Don, Maxine, and Bob, who were her pride and joy. Her legacy continues through her 10 grandchildren, 20 great-grandchildren, and 2 great-great-grandchildren, each carrying forward a piece of her spirit.
She did her crossword puzzles in ink and loved to beat the buzzer in Jeopardy! She was a long-time member of the Presbyterian Church in Muscatine, was actively involved in the Muscatine General Federation of Women's Phoenix Club, several book clubs, and cherished her years with her bridge group.
Shirley was predeceased by her beloved husband, Rick and daughter Patti.
The family extends their heartfelt gratitude to the compassionate caregivers at Muscatine Lutheran assisted living, whose dedication and kindness provided comfort to Shirley in her final year.
